Performance Comparison: H6, H7, and H8 Batteries

When it comes to comparing the performance of H6, H7, and H8 batteries, you’ll notice distinct differences in their power capabilities. Understanding these differences is crucial in order to make the optimal battery choice for your specific needs. Here is a breakdown of the battery performance of H6, H7, and H8 batteries:

  1. Capacity: The capacity of a battery refers to the amount of energy it can store. The H6 battery typically has a capacity of around 60 ampere-hours (Ah), while the H7 battery has a capacity of around 70 Ah, and the H8 battery has a capacity of around 80 Ah. This means that the H8 battery can store more energy and provide longer periods of use before needing to be recharged.
  2. Cold Cranking Amps (CCA): CCA is a measure of a battery’s ability to start an engine in cold temperatures. The higher the CCA rating, the better the battery can perform in cold weather. The H6 battery typically has a CCA rating of around 700, the H7 battery has a rating of around 800, and the H8 battery has a rating of around 900. This means that the H8 battery is more suitable for colder climates.
  3. Reserve Capacity (RC): RC is a measure of how long a battery can power essential electrical systems in case of alternator failure. The H6 battery typically has a RC of around 120 minutes, the H7 battery has a RC of around 140 minutes, and the H8 battery has a RC of around 160 minutes. This means that the H8 battery can provide power for a longer duration in case of emergencies.
  4. Dimensions and Weight: H6, H7, and H8 batteries have different physical dimensions and weights. The H6 battery is generally smaller and lighter than the H7 and H8 batteries. This can be a factor to consider when fitting the battery into your vehicle.

Cost Considerations: Finding the Best Value in H6, H7, and H8 Batteries

For the best value in H6, H7, and H8 batteries, you should consider the cost and compare it to the features and benefits they offer. One important factor to consider is battery lifespan. The lifespan of a battery refers to the amount of time it can provide power before needing to be replaced. This is crucial when determining the overall cost effectiveness of a battery.

H6 batteries typically have a shorter lifespan compared to H7 and H8 batteries. They’re designed for smaller vehicles and have a lower capacity, which means they may need to be replaced more frequently. On the other hand, H7 and H8 batteries are designed for larger vehicles and have a higher capacity, resulting in a longer lifespan.

When considering cost effectiveness, it’s important to calculate the cost per year of battery usage. While H6 batteries may be initially cheaper, their shorter lifespan means you’ll need to replace them more frequently, resulting in higher long-term costs. H7 and H8 batteries may have a higher upfront cost, but their longer lifespan means they’ll need to be replaced less often, ultimately saving you money in the long run.
